BlackRock, Inc., founded in 1988 by Larry Fink and a group of partners, is the world’s largest asset management firm, headquartered in New York City. Initially starting as a risk management and fixed-income institutional asset manager, it has grown to manage over $10 trillion in assets through a combination of organic growth and strategic acquisitions, such as its 2009 purchase of Barclays Global Investors. BlackRock is known for its extensive range of investment products, including mutual funds, ETFs (notably under the iShares brand), and alternative investments, serving clients ranging from individuals to governments.

BlackRock's Q3 2025 Portfolio in Review

As of Q3 2025, BlackRock held 5,636 positions worth $5.71T, up 8.7% from $5.25T the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 30% of the portfolio.

BlackRock's Q3 2025 filing shows 188 new, 2,412 increased, 2,226 reduced and 181 closed positions. Its largest new stake was Paramount Skydance Corp: 16,557,304 shares worth $313M. The largest sale was Hess, an estimated $3.58B.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 32% of assets, up from 31%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Consumer Discretionary.
